The IlvDisplaceFilter Class
The IlvDisplaceFilter class lets you displace pixels from an image using pixel values of another image.
This is the transformation to be performed:
P'(x,y) <- P( x + scale * ((XC(x,y) - .5), y + scale * (YC(x,y) - .5))
where:
*P(x,y) is the input image.
*P'(x,y) is the destination.
*XC(x,y) and YC(x,y) are the component values of the displacement map. They can be chosen from any of the color components of the image map (an example is that the Red component displaces in X while the Alpha component displaces in Y.
*scale is a user-specified scaling value.
